NATURAL GAS VOLUME definition

NATURAL GAS VOLUME means a quantity of NATURAL GAS Vn expressed in cubic meters (m3). The NATURAL GAS VOLUME in Annex 2 Metering Manual are usually related to a certain period of time (e.g. 15', hour, day, or month). If no period of time is specified, then the term NATURAL GAS VOLUME is used in its general meaning.
